German conservative parliamentary leader resigns over surrogate baby controversy

4 days ago

Jens Spahn, the parliamentary head of German Chancellor Friedrich Merz's CDU faction, resigned on Saturday amid mounting pressure over his use of a surrogate mother in the US despite a surrogacy ban in Germany. Spahn and his husband welcomed the child earlier this week, sparking criticisms of hypocrisy and double standards.
